Abstract

The utility model relates to the technical field of headphones, in particular to a hanging piece and an earphone. The hanging piece comprises a connecting part and a hanging part, the connecting part is suitable for being connected to the earphone, the hanging part is detachably connected to the connecting part, clearance fit is formed between the hanging part and the connecting part, so that the hanging part can rotate around the axis of the connecting part, and the hanging part is suitable for hanging accessories. The earphone comprises the above hanging piece. Through the hanging piece, the ornament can be hung on the earphone, and the personalized design of the earphone is improved.

[0059] Based on this, in order to solve the technical problem that the existing headphones 20 lack any decorations, novelty, and the ability to meet users' personalized needs, refer to Figures 1 to 10This utility model provides a hanging member 10 for attaching jewelry 30 (e.g., earrings, studs, earrings, or other decorative items) to an earphone 20. The hanging member 10 includes a connecting portion 100, a hanging portion 200, and a limiting ring 300. The connecting portion 100 is adapted to connect to the earphone 20. For example, the earphone 20 may have a corresponding connecting hole 411, into which the connecting portion 100 can be inserted, or threadedly connected. The hanging portion 200 is detachably connected to the connecting portion 100, and a clearance fit is formed between the hanging portion 200 and the connecting portion 100, allowing the hanging portion 200 to rotate around the axis of the connecting portion 100. The hanging portion 200 is suitable for attaching jewelry 30. The limiting ring 300 is connected to the connecting part 100 and is used to limit the hook part 200 to the connecting part 100 to prevent the hook part 200 from falling off the connecting part 100.

[0060] Specifically, in this embodiment, the aforementioned hanging member 10 enables the attachment of ornaments 30 to the earphones 20, satisfying the user's personalized customization of the earphones 20. When it is necessary to attach ornaments 30 to the earphones 20, the hanging member 10 is first assembled: the first step is to connect the hanging part 200 to the connecting part 100, and the second step is to connect the limiting ring 300 to the connecting part 100. The limiting ring 300 can limit the hanging part 200 to the connecting part 100, ensuring the connection stability between the hanging part 200 and the connecting part 100 and preventing the hanging part 200 from falling off the connecting part 100. After the hanging member 10 is assembled, it is connected to the earphones 20 using the connecting part 100. At this time, the ornaments 30 can be attached to the hanging part 200, thus decorating the earphones 20. When it is necessary to replace the jewelry 30, simply remove the old jewelry 30 from the hanging part 200 and reattach the new jewelry 30 to the hanging part 200. During the replacement of jewelry 30, there is no need to detach the hanging part 10 from the earphone 20, ensuring convenience and simplifying the replacement process. When it is not necessary to attach jewelry 30 to the earphone 20, first detach jewelry 30 from the hanging part 200, then detach the hanging part 10 from the earphone 20, and finally disassemble the hanging part 10: first, detach the limiting ring 300 from the connecting part 100, and second, detach the hanging part 200 from the connecting part 100. This ultimately allows for the storage of jewelry 30 and hanging part 10, preventing the loss of jewelry 30 or hanging part 10.

[0061] The mounting bracket 10 provided in this embodiment offers flexible assembly and disassembly methods, allowing for easy installation and removal. It facilitates both connecting the mounting bracket 10 to the earphone 20 and removing it from the earphone 20. The mounting bracket 10 enables the attachment of ornaments 30 to the earphone 20, enhancing its novelty and uniqueness, satisfying users' personalized needs, and significantly improving the wearing experience. Furthermore, in this embodiment, the ornament 30 is easily attached to and removed from the mounting bracket 10 (specifically, the mounting part 200), ensuring ease of installation, removal, and replacement.

[0062] In this hook-on 10, a gap fit is formed between the hook-on part 200 and the connecting part 100, so that the hook-on part 200 can rotate around the axis of the connecting part 100. When the hook-on part 200 rotates, the hook-on part 200 will drive the ornament 30 hanging on it to rotate together, so that the user can freely adjust the display angle of the ornament 30 according to his / her own style.

[0063] In some embodiments, refer to Figure 7 The connecting part 100 includes a connecting rod 130 and a connecting body 140, which are detachably connected.

[0064] Specifically, in this embodiment, the connecting rod 130 and the connecting body 140 can be connected together by threads. Alternatively, the connecting rod 130 and the connecting body 140 can be snapped together. Alternatively, the connecting rod 130 and the connecting body 140 can be magnetically connected together. The connecting rod 130 and the connecting body 140 adopt a detachable structure, which facilitates the storage of the hanger 10.

[0065] In some embodiments, refer to Figures 5 to 9 The connecting portion 100 is provided with a connecting groove 110, and the hook portion 200 is provided with a connecting ring 210. The connecting ring 210 is configured to fit into the connecting groove 110 so that the hook portion 200 is connected to the connecting portion 100. Referring to the above embodiment, the limiting ring 300 can be connected to one end of the connecting groove 110 to limit the connecting ring 210 within the connecting groove 110.

[0066] Specifically, in this embodiment, the hanging part 200 is connected to the connecting groove 110 via the connecting ring 210. On the one hand, this ensures the connection stability between the hanging part 200 and the connecting part 100, and the connecting groove 110 restricts the movement of the hanging part 200 along the axial direction of the connecting part 100. On the other hand, this ensures that the overall structure of the hanging part 10 is small and compact, reducing the volume of the hanging part 10 along the axial direction perpendicular to the connecting part 100, avoiding the aesthetics of hanging ornaments 30 due to the excessive volume of the hanging part 10, and improving the "invisibility effect" of the hanging part 10.

[0067] In some embodiments, refer to Figure 7 A silicone layer 120 is provided on the outer peripheral wall of the connecting groove 110, and the inner peripheral wall of the connecting ring 210 is in contact with the silicone layer 120.

[0068] Specifically, in this embodiment, the silicone layer 120 increases the friction between the inner peripheral wall of the connecting ring 210 and the outer peripheral wall of the connecting groove 110, that is, the silicone layer 120 increases the friction between the hanging part 200 and the connecting part 100. By setting the silicone layer 120, while ensuring that the hanging part 200 can rotate freely, the friction between the hanging part 200 and the connecting part 100 can be used to position the hanging part 200 at a certain rotation angle, ensuring that the ornament 30 can be positioned at a certain display angle. In addition, by setting the silicone layer 120, the frictional feel of the hanging part 200 when rotating can be increased, allowing the user to feel the rotation of the hanging part 200.

[0069] In some embodiments, the angle α by which the hanging part 200 rotates about the axis of the connecting part 100 satisfies: 0° ≤ α ≤ 360°. For example, the value of α can be 0°, 60°, 90°, 180°, 270°, 360°, etc. It should be noted that when the value of α is 0°, it means that the hanging part 200 does not rotate, and correspondingly, the ornament 30 on the hanging part 200 is displayed facing forward; when the value of α is 360°, it means that the hanging part 200 rotates one full turn, and correspondingly, the ornament 30 on the hanging part 200 is displayed with its back facing forward.

[0070] Specifically, in this embodiment, by freely rotating the hanging part 200, the ornament 30 on the hanging part 200 can be rotated together, thereby making it convenient for the user to adjust the display angle of the ornament 30 and realize the user's personalized display of the ornament 30.

[0071] In some embodiments, the retaining ring 300 is a structure made of stainless steel. (See reference...) Figure 10 In order to facilitate adjustment of the size of the limit ring 300, the limit ring 300 may be provided with an opening.

[0072] Specifically, in this embodiment, the limiting ring 300 is made of stainless steel. On the one hand, this improves the corrosion resistance of the limiting ring 300 and extends its service life. On the other hand, because stainless steel has a certain degree of toughness, before the limiting ring 300 is connected to the connecting part 100, the size enclosed by the limiting ring 300 can be enlarged using a jig (specifically, the jig is applied to the opening of the limiting ring 300, and an outward pushing force is applied to the opening, making the opening of the limiting ring 300 larger, thereby increasing the size enclosed by the limiting ring 300). After the limiting ring 300 is connected to the connecting part 100, the size enclosed by the limiting ring 300 can be reduced using a jig (specifically, the jig is applied to the outer periphery of the limiting ring 300, and an inward pressure is applied to the limiting ring 300, making the opening of the limiting ring 300 smaller, thereby reducing the size enclosed by the limiting ring 300). When the size enclosed by the limiting ring 300 is reduced, the connection stability between it and the connecting part 100 is improved, thereby providing a good limiting effect on the hook part 200 and preventing the hook part 200 from falling off the connecting part 100.

[0073] In some embodiments, refer to Figure 9 The hanging part 200 includes a fixed part 220, a movable part 230, and an elastic member 250. The movable part 230 is connected to the fixed part 220 via a connecting shaft 240. The elastic member 250 extends circumferentially around the connecting shaft 240, with one end connected to the fixed part 220 and the other end connected to the movable part 230. A hanging hole 260 for hanging the ornament 30 is formed between the fixed part 220 and the movable part 230.

[0074] Specifically, in this embodiment, the size of the hanging hole 260 can be freely adjusted by stretching the movable part 230. When the ornament 30 is hung on the hanging part 200, an outward pulling force is applied to the movable part 230, causing the movable part 230 to move away from the fixed part 220. At the same time, the elastic member 250 undergoes elastic deformation after being stretched, and the size of the hanging hole 260 increases, making it easier to hang the ornament 30 on the hanging part 200. After the ornament 30 is hung on the hanging part 200, the external force applied to the movable part 230 is stopped. The elastic member 250 has a tendency to restore its elastic deformation, causing the elastic member 250 to drive the movable part 230 to move closer to the fixed part 220. At this time, the size of the hanging hole 260 decreases, which helps to clamp the ornament 30 in the hanging hole 260, ensuring the connection stability between the ornament 30 and the hanging part 200 and preventing the ornament 30 from falling off the hanging part 200.

[0075] Correspondingly, refer to Figures 1 to 4Another embodiment of this utility model also provides an earphone 20, which can be a headphone 20, and the earphone 20 includes the hook member 10 in any of the above embodiments. The earphone 20 also includes an earcup 400, which includes a side wall 410 and a connection hole 411. The connecting part 100 of the hook member 10 is connected to the connection hole 411.

[0076] Specifically, in this embodiment, when it is necessary to attach an accessory 30 to the earphone 20, firstly, the accessory 10 is connected to the side wall 410 of the earcup 400 through the mating connection between the connecting part 100 and the connecting hole 411. Next, the accessory 30 is attached to the attaching part 200 of the accessory 10, thus attaching the accessory 30 to the earcup 400. The accessory 30 decorates the earcup 400, enhancing the novelty and uniqueness of the earphone 20 and meeting the user's personalized needs. When it is necessary to replace the accessory 30, the old accessory 30 is simply removed from the attaching part 200, and a new accessory 30 is reattached to the attaching part 200. During the replacement of the accessory 30, it is not necessary to remove the attaching part 10 from the earcup 400, ensuring convenience and simplifying the operation steps for replacing the accessory 30. When it is necessary to remove the jewelry 30, simply remove the jewelry 30 directly from the hanging part 200 to facilitate the storage of the jewelry 30 and prevent the jewelry 30 from falling off the earmuff 400 and being lost.

[0077] The earmuff 400 is compatible with various sizes of hanging accessories 10. For example, the earmuff 400 can accommodate large, medium, and small hanging accessories 10, where "large," "medium," and "small" represent the size and structural strength of the hanging accessories 10. The large hanging accessory 10 has a larger size and higher structural strength, therefore it can be used to hang larger and heavier ornaments 30. The medium hanging accessory 10 has a medium size and medium structural strength, therefore it can be used to hang medium-sized and medium-weight ornaments 30. The small hanging accessory 10 has a smaller size and lower structural strength, therefore it can be used to hang smaller and lighter ornaments 30. Selecting a suitable size of hanging piece 10 based on the model of the jewelry 30 can avoid the situation where a smaller size hanging piece 10 cannot support a larger size jewelry 30, ensuring the stability of hanging the jewelry 30. It can also avoid the situation where a larger size hanging piece 10 hangs a smaller size jewelry 30, resulting in an unbalanced appearance and preventing the jewelry 30 from standing out.

[0078] In some embodiments, refer to Figures 3 to 7The connecting hole 411 is provided with an internal thread, and the connecting part 100 is provided with an external thread. The external thread and the internal thread are matched to thread the connecting part 100 into the connecting hole 411.

[0079] Specifically, in this embodiment, when the hanger 10 is installed on the earcup 400, firstly, the connecting part 100 is inserted into the connecting hole 411. Then, the hanger 10 is screwed on so that the connecting part 100 is tightened in the connecting hole 411, thereby realizing the connection and assembly of the hanger 10 and the earcup 400. At this time, the ornament 30 can be hung on the hanger 10 to decorate the earphone 20. When removing the hanger 10 from the earcup 400, the hanger 10 is screwed on in the opposite direction to separate the hanger 10 from the earcup 400.

[0080] The connector 10 and the earcup 400 are connected by threads, which not only facilitates the installation, removal and replacement of the connector 10 and the earcup 400, but also ensures the stability of the connection between the connector 10 and the earcup 400, preventing the connector 10 from easily falling off the earcup 400.

[0081] In some embodiments, a first magnetic attraction part is provided in the connection hole 411, and a second magnetic attraction part is provided in the connection part 100. The second magnetic attraction part is configured to attract each other with the first magnetic attraction part so as to magnetically connect the connection part 100 to the connection hole 411.

[0082] Specifically, in this embodiment, when the hanger 10 is installed on the earcup 400, firstly, the connecting part 100 is inserted into the connecting hole 411. Then, the connecting part 100 is pushed into the connecting hole 411. As the connecting part 100 is continuously inserted into the connecting hole 411, the magnetic attraction between the second magnetic part and the first magnetic part gradually increases. Utilizing the magnetic attraction between the second magnetic part and the first magnetic part, a stable connection between the hanger 10 and the earcup 400 can be ensured. When the hanger 10 is removed from the earcup 400, the connecting part 100 is pulled out of the connecting hole 411. As the connecting part 100 is continuously moved out of the connecting hole 411, the magnetic attraction between the second magnetic part and the first magnetic part gradually weakens, thereby achieving the separation and detachment of the hanger 10 and the earcup 400.

[0083] The connector 10 and the earcup 400 are connected by magnetic attraction, which not only ensures the connection strength between the connector 10 and the earcup 400, making the connection secure, but also prevents the connector 10 from easily falling off the earcup 400 even under vibration or bumps. Furthermore, even if the connector 10 and the earcup 400 are connected and separated multiple times, the magnetic attraction performance of the first and second magnetic parts remains essentially unchanged, resulting in a long service life for the connector 10.

[0084] In some embodiments, a first adhesive portion is provided in the connecting hole 411, and a second adhesive portion is provided in the connecting portion 100. The second adhesive portion is configured to adhere to the first adhesive portion to bond the connecting portion 100 to the connecting hole 411.

[0085] Specifically, in this embodiment, when the hanger 10 is installed on the earcup 400, firstly, the connecting part 100 is inserted into the connecting hole 411. Then, the connecting part 100 is pushed into the connecting hole 411. As the connecting part 100 is continuously inserted into the connecting hole 411, the adhesive force between the second adhesive part and the first adhesive part gradually increases. Utilizing the adhesive force between the second adhesive part and the first adhesive part, a stable connection between the hanger 10 and the earcup 400 can be ensured. When the hanger 10 is removed from the earcup 400, the connecting part 100 is pulled out of the connecting hole 411. As the connecting part 100 is continuously moved out of the connecting hole 411, the adhesive force between the second adhesive part and the first adhesive part gradually weakens, thereby achieving the separation and disassembly of the hanger 10 and the earcup 400.

[0086] The fastener 10 and the earmuff 400 are bonded together, which not only reduces the manufacturing difficulty of the fastener 10 and the earmuff 400, ensuring that the first bonding part can adapt to any shape of the connecting hole 411, and ensuring that the second bonding part can adapt to any shape of the connecting part 100; but also reduces the manufacturing cost of the fastener 10 and the earmuff 400.
